The "best" vintage Polaroid camera depends on whether you value professional-grade optics or a reliable, easy "point-and-shoot" experience. It features Polaroid's patented "Sonar" autofocus, which uses sound waves to ensure sharp shots automatically. It uses widely available 600 film and has a built-in flash, making it versatile for both indoor and outdoor use. Typical Price: Around $199 for refurbished units.
